Module::CPANTS::Kwalitee::Signature(3pm) User Contributed Perl Documentation Module::CPANTS::Kwalitee::Signature(3pm)NAMEModule::CPANTS::Kwalitee::Signature - dist has a valid signatureSYNOPSISCheck if the cryptographic signature of a dist is valid.DESCRIPTIONMethods order Defines the order in which Kwalitee tests should be run. Returns 100. analyse Uses "Module::Signature" to verify the validity of the dist signature. Dists without signature pass automatically. kwalitee_indicators Returns the Kwalitee Indicators datastructure. o valid_signatureSEE ALSOModule::CPANTS::AnalyseAUTHORLars DXXXXXX "<daxim@cpan.org>"LICENCE AND COPYRIGHTCopyright X 2012, Lars DXXXXXX "<daxim@cpan.org>".
